One of the significant features of modern tape production technology is the introduction of advanced adhesive formulations. These formulations provide superior bonding strength, allowing the tape to adhere well to multiple surfaces, including metal, plastic, and fabric. Moreover, the development of weather-resistant and UV-resistant tapes ensures that users can rely on their effectiveness in diverse environmental conditions. This is particularly crucial for outdoor applications where exposure to moisture and sunlight can compromise the durability of traditional tapes.
Another noteworthy advancement is the manufacturing process, which emphasizes precision and consistency. Techniques such as coating technology and film extrusion have led to the production of tapes with uniform thickness and properties. This consistency enhances usability, allowing for easier application and reduced waste. Users have reported that these features significantly minimize the mistakes often associated with tape application, resulting in cleaner finishes and less frustration during projects.
